La Caixa and Repsol YPF to maintain Gas Natural pacts (La Caixa y Repsol YPF preven mantener los pactos aunque pierdan peso en la gasista catalana tras la OPA).

In Spain, savings bank La Caixa and oil group Repsol YPF have decided to maintain their shareholders' pacts at gas company Gas Natural, even if their respective stakes fall below 15 per cent. La Caixa, with 33 per cent of Gas Natural, and Repsol YPF, with 30 per cent, agreed in 2000 to collaborate within the company as long as their individual stakes remained above the 15 per cent threshold.
